[Video] Fanfarlo :: The Walls Are Coming Down


Often music videos are overly complicated. Either the director is trying cram too many metaphors into a three-minute box, or the cut-scenes and special effects detract from the song itself. Thankfully, directors Iain Forsyth & Jane Pollard employed simplicity alongside Fanfarlo in the video for "The Walls Are Coming Down." Featuring Roslyn Walker, one of the few living professional escape artists, the video's only other props are a couple of well-placed spotlights.

The Racoon Wedding :: Gather Gather Bones/Rattle Rattle Truth

Download The Paper Boy from The Racoon Wedding's album, Gather Gather Bones/Rattle Rattle Truth Sounds Like : they're gonna rip your ribcage out and find your heart RIYL : White Rabbits, Portugal. The Man, Fanfarlo, Rolling Stones ala Beggar's Banquet From the Press Release : Forming from the ashes of Vermicious Knid, and authoring songs in the basement of the all ages not-for-profit art space they own in a nook of the city’s forgotten downtown, frontman Tim Ford and company boast a sense of loyalty to their community that few other bands share. On their debut LP, Gather Gather Bones/Rattle Rattle Truth , issued this October via their own Ford Plant Recordings Co., the band enlisted the help of engineer Leon Taheny (of the Final Fantasy recording credit) and hammered out a record that teems with the spirit of long-forgotten roots music. It’s indebted to the history of mighty back porch music: unbridled, unedited, beautifully intense.
